ANGOLA
Brian & Debbie Howden
thank us for
praying
for their recent visit. The 6000 Portuguese Bibles and other
literature and supplies were safely and speedily released through
customs and arrived at
Camundambala
a day or so before our arrival. This was a tremendous answer to
prayer.
We were able to give
help to the older men of the Assembly at
Camundambala
on the doctrines of the gospel which was received
with willingness and humility.
Brian
was able to give teaching on some serious issues that were affecting
the fellowship at
Caungula,
and a week of 6:00 am Bible readings at an
Assembly in
Saurimo. There were about 250 in
attendance for the studies on various aspects of the NT church – the
simple truths were a revelation to many of the believers.
It was not such a good
time in repairing the printing machines; these are necessary for the
printing of books and Bible courses, but it was not possible to get
them to work again, and was very frustrating since there is a
continuous call for courses to be provided.

MALAWI
Stephen Harper
has taken delivery of the 2016 calendars and has
begun distribution of 50,000 calendars and around 30,000 tracts.
Some of those involved in the distribution are getting up at 4:00am,
and cycling for 4 hours. What a privilege to carry the glorious
Gospel of Christ – the only message which can free the 17 million
population from the chains of sin!
